Guerneville, CA (ZIP 95446) has a moderate disaster history with 43 recorded events. These include 25 wildfires, 16 floods, and 1 earthquake. Total documented property damage amounts to $214.3M. Across all recorded events, 2 deaths have been attributed to natural disasters in this area.
With 25 recorded incidents (58% of all events), wildfires are the leading natural hazard for this ZIP code. Of these, 2 (8%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for wildfire-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). The most recent recorded wildfire occurred on Sep 11, 2020.
There have been 16 recorded floods in this area, representing 37% of all disaster events. Of these, 3 (19%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for flood-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). Flood-related events have caused a combined $214.2M in documented property damage. 2 fatalities have been attributed to floods in this area. The most recent recorded flood occurred on Feb 4, 2025.
Guerneville has experienced 1 earthquake on record. The most recent recorded earthquake occurred on Jul 28, 2021.
Guerneville has experienced 1 tornado on record. Tornado-related events have caused a combined $150K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ded tornado occurred on Jan 27, 2005.
The most significant disaster event on record for Guerneville was Flood on Jan 1, 2006, which caused $107M in property damage. Another major event was Flood (Dec 31, 2005), causing $107M in damages.
